Cranberry Almond Muffins Topped with Raw Sugar

A delicious muffin with fruit, almonds, and a sugary topping ~ perfect for breakfast or anytime you crave a sweet treat.











Ingredients (for 12 muffins):
1 3/4 cups flour
1 cup sugar
1/2 teaspoon sea salt
1/2 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 cup canola oil
2 eggs, beaten
1 teaspoon almond extract
1/2 cup dried cranberries
1/2 cup slivered almonds + 1/4 cup for topping
2 teaspoons raw sugar (or white sugar)


Directions:
Preheat oven to 400 degrees.
In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, sugar, salt, and baking soda.



In a measuring cup, mix oil, eggs, and almond extract.  Add to dry ingredients.  Stir only until combined.



Add cranberries and slivered almonds.



Spoon into greased muffin cups or line with paper.



Bake for 20 minutes or until done.  Cool and Enjoy!  ♥

Spiced Banana Oatmeal Muffins

There is nothing better than quick bread to make a meal complete.  Gather your ingredients, mix by hand, bake for 20 minutes, and you are ready to serve.  I love to serve muffins with a hot soup main dish.  Yesterday I thought I would add oatmeal and a few spices.
The results were perfect for dinner and for breakfast the next morning!



Ingredients (serves 12):
1 1/2 cups flour (or a combination of white and whole wheat flour)
1 teaspoon cinnamon
1/4 teaspoon nutmeg
1/4 teaspoon ground cloves
1/2 teaspoon sea salt
1 teaspoon baking powder
1 teaspoon baking soda
2 bananas (3 small bananas)
1 egg
5 1/3 tablespoons melted unsalted butter (1/3 cup)
1 teaspoon vanilla
1 cup dry oatmeal
3/4 cup brown sugar

Directions:
Preheat oven to 350 degrees.
Whisk together flour, spices, salt, baking powder, and baking soda in a medium bowl.


In a large bowl, whisk butter and sugar.  Add egg and vanilla.


Add bananas.  Mix completely.
Stir the egg mixture into the flour mix only until blended.

 
 
Mix in oats.  Spoon batter into paper lined muffin pan.


Bake for 20 minutes or until muffins are golden brown.


Cool, serve, and enjoy!  ♥

Banana Chocolate Chip Muffins with a Streusel Topping

Always a dilemma to figure out what to do with all of those overly ripe bananas!  My normal go-to would be a banana bread.  But today I decided to add a couple of my favorites ~ chocolate chips and cinnamon ~ and make muffins!

The results were better than I could have hoped!


Ingredients (for 12 muffins):
Muffins
1/3 cup unsalted butter, melted
4 small bananas or 3 large bananas, mashed
1 cup sugar
1 egg, beaten
1 teaspoon vanilla
1 1/2 cups flour
1 teaspoon baking soda
1/4 teaspoon salt

Streusel Topping
1/3 cup brown sugar
2 tablespoons flour
1/2 teaspoon cinnamon
1 tablespoon cold butter



Directions: 
Preheat oven to 350 degrees
In a large bowl, mix together bananas and melted butter



Stir in sugar, egg, and vanilla.




In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, and salt.  Add to the banana mixture and stir only until combined.  Add chocolate chips.


Spoon into paper lined muffin pan.  
Make streusel topping
 Mix together brown sugar, flour, cinnamon.  Cut in butter until crumbs are formed.
Sprinkle the muffins with the topping.


Bake for 25 minutes or until lightly browned.


Cool and enjoy



Freezes well!  ♥
